I'm getting a strange, random error when running CTest...I've searched all over and haven't been able to find anybody else with the same problem.
[...]Each individual test executable runs fine, and none of them include any randomness (e.g. generating random numbers as inputs to tests, which could conceivably cause some weird erratic crashes). I'm using CMake 2.6.2 on Arch Linux i686. Any ideas what might be wrong, or where I should look for clues? Thanks!
One potential source of randomness is failing or iffy hardware. Have you kept track of such things as systematic changes in system temperature under the same load conditions? I must clean out the dust from one of my boxes every 6 months or I see dramatically increasing temperatures (like 10 C) under heavy system load. The other box has much better air flow design so the the problem isn't as critical there. Have you tried running memtest? What happens if you try running your ctests on an entirely different machine?
